Partner Society Symposia - SLARD: Medial Collateral Ligament - From Anatomy to Reconstruction
|
|
|
|
|
Moderator:
David H. Figueroa, MD CHILE
|
|
|
|
|
After this symposium, the attendees will be able to understand the anatomy, bio-mechanics, and treatment of medial knee ligament injuries, as well as the quantitative techniques for the measurement of anatomic structures and bio-mechanical testing and images that have improved anatomic definition of the severity of injuries. On the other hand the development of new repair and reconstruction techniques that may lead to improved surgical outcomes will be discussed.
